Background
At present, with the development and progress of the energy-saving technology of the heat pump, the ambient temperature range of the heat pump is wider and wider. Particularly, after the enhanced vapor injection compressor is matched with the R410a refrigerant, the temperature range of stable operation of the compressor is expanded to be below 35 ℃ below zero, so that the heat pump can meet the use requirements under a wider range of environmental temperatures.
However, according to this operation characteristic of the heat pump, when it is operated in an ultra-low temperature environment, the suction pressure of the compressor is relatively small, and the discharge pressure is relatively high, so that a relatively large difference is formed between the discharge pressure and the suction pressure difference. Further, in the event of frost formation, the difference between the compressor suction pressure and discharge pressure may be greater. And the difference value between the exhaust pressure and the suction pressure of the compressor is too large, so that the compressor runs at super-mechanical strength, the problem of heat pump failure is caused, and the use experience of a user is influenced.

The application provides a compressor ultralow-temperature safe operation control method, which aims to realize the adjustment of the suction pressure and the exhaust pressure of a compressor through the frequency adjustment of the compressor, further reduce the difference between the real-time suction pressure and the real-time exhaust pressure of the compressor and avoid the condition that the compressor runs with ultra-mechanical strength. Under the condition of running of the existing heat pump in an ultralow temperature environment, the exhaust pressure of a compressor is relatively large, the suction pressure of the compressor is relatively small, and therefore a large difference is generated between the suction pressure and the exhaust pressure of the compressor, and the compressor bears stress with certain strength due to the difference. And, along with the difference between suction pressure and discharge pressure increases gradually, can make the stress that the compressor inside bore increase gradually, the compressor is super mechanical strength operation to the too big messenger of the compressor inside bore stress, can make the compressor wear and tear seriously and burn out, and then influence the work efficiency of compressor, even make the heat pump operation trouble appear. Therefore, the method for controlling the ultralow-temperature safe operation of the compressor in the embodiment of the application is provided to solve the problem that the difference between the suction pressure and the discharge pressure is too large under the ultralow-temperature operation condition of the compressor.

s110, pre-setting corresponding exhaust pressure thresholds of the compressor under different suction pressures, wherein the exhaust pressure thresholds are set according to exhaust pressure boundary value information, and the exhaust pressure boundary value is a maximum exhaust pressure value allowed by safe operation of the compressor under the corresponding different suction pressures.
In order to realize the adjustment of the real-time suction pressure and the real-time discharge pressure of the compressor, the difference value between the suction pressure and the discharge pressure of the compressor is reduced. It is necessary to preset a discharge pressure threshold of the compressor at the corresponding suction pressure. I.e., the compressor is at any suction pressure, there will be a corresponding discharge pressure threshold. When the discharge pressure of the discharge port of the compressor is below the discharge pressure threshold value, the difference value between the suction pressure and the discharge pressure of the compressor is within the range allowed by the safe operation of the compressor. And once the discharge pressure of the compressor exceeds the discharge pressure threshold, the difference between the suction pressure and the discharge pressure of the compressor exceeds the allowable range of safe operation of the compressor, and the compressor can bear large stress when operating under the condition of the pressure difference, so that the compressor has the condition of ultra-mechanical strength operation. Therefore, it is necessary to set a discharge pressure threshold value for each suction pressure of the compressor in advance. In the embodiment of the present application, the suction pressure and the discharge pressure of the compressor may be collected according to air pressure sensors respectively disposed at an air inlet and an air outlet of the compressor. There are many ways to collect the suction pressure and the discharge pressure of the compressor, and the embodiment of the application is not limited fixedly.
Specifically, the exhaust pressure threshold is set according to information of an exhaust pressure boundary value, and the exhaust pressure boundary value is a maximum exhaust pressure value allowed by safe operation of the compressor corresponding to different suction pressures. In order to determine the corresponding discharge pressure boundary value at each suction pressure, a safety experiment for the operation of the compressor needs to be performed corresponding to each suction pressure. In the operation safety experiment of the compressor, the experiment is respectively carried out corresponding to each suction pressure value in a variable control mode, the exhaust pressure of the compressor is continuously adjusted under the condition that the suction pressure value is not changed, and when the exhaust pressure of the compressor reaches the maximum stress value which can be born by the safe operation of the compressor, the exhaust pressure value of the compressor at the moment is considered as an exhaust pressure boundary value under the corresponding suction pressure. Further, the exhaust pressure boundary value is set as an exhaust pressure threshold value corresponding to the intake pressure, or the exhaust pressure threshold value is set based on the exhaust pressure boundary value in consideration of the influence of measurement, calculation variation, or the like. Further, during the setting of the exhaust pressure threshold. The corresponding exhaust pressure boundary value is acquired when the suction pressure changes in the operation safety experiment of the compressor. And generating a compressor operation safety block diagram based on different suction pressures and corresponding discharge pressure boundary values. The compressor operation safety block diagram comprises corresponding exhaust pressure boundary values under different suction pressures, and the exhaust pressure threshold value is set based on the compressor operation safety block diagram when the exhaust pressure threshold value is set subsequently. When the compressor operates, the air suction pressure and the air discharge pressure are both in the interior of the block diagram, the compressor is safe to operate, and if the air discharge pressure value of the compressor exceeds the operation safety block diagram of the compressor under a certain air suction pressure, pressure adjustment is needed to avoid the overlarge difference value between the air suction pressure and the air discharge pressure of the compressor.
And S120, after the compressor is started, detecting a real-time suction pressure value and a real-time exhaust pressure value of the compressor, and determining a corresponding exhaust pressure threshold according to the real-time suction pressure value.
And when the compressor starts to work, the interface carries out safe control on the operation of the compressor in real time so that the discharge pressure of the compressor is operated in a safe range. When the compressor starts to operate, the real-time suction pressure value P of the air inlet of the compressor is detectedsAnd real-time discharge pressure value P of compressor discharge portd. Further based on the collected real-time suction pressure value PsComparing the compressor operation safety diagram to obtain the real-time suction pressure value PdCorresponding exhaust pressure threshold value Pdmax. Based on the determined real-time exhaust pressure value PdAnd comparing the exhaust pressure threshold value P obtained by the compressor operation safety block diagramdmaxThe two pressure values can be compared, and whether the current compressor exhaust pressure value exceeds the safe operation range of the compressor or not is judged.
S130, comparing the real-time exhaust pressure value with the exhaust pressure threshold, and when the real-time exhaust pressure value reaches the exhaust pressure threshold, performing frequency adjustment on the compressor in a corresponding frequency adjustment mode according to the current frequency modulation stage of the compressor so as to reduce the difference between the suction pressure and the exhaust pressure.
When the compressor is designed, the mechanical strength and the friction clearance of the structure have the maximum threshold, the suction pressure of the compressor can be increased and the discharge pressure can be reduced by means of frequency reduction, and the difference value between the discharge pressure and the suction pressure can be reduced, so that the mechanical strength stress in the compressor is reduced. Therefore, in order to reduce the mechanical strength stress inside the compressor and avoid the compressor from operating beyond the mechanical strength, the frequency adjustment of the compressor is required.

Illustratively, the compressor is operated in a steady frequency phase, at which time the discharge pressure threshold P is presetdmaxCorresponding to the first preset positive deviation value A, when the real-time exhaust pressure value P is detectedd≥Pdmax+ A indicates that the difference between the suction pressure and the discharge pressure of the compressor is too large due to too large discharge pressure value of the current compressor, and the pressure difference of the compressor needs to be adjusted. The compressor is controlled to perform down-conversion at a first preset rate S1 corresponding to the current frequency modulation stage. The first preset rate S1 is experimentally measured by making the discharge pressure value Pd≥ PdmaxAnd if the + A condition is satisfied, selecting different frequency reduction rates to perform the frequency reduction adjustment of the compressor, and finally selecting the most suitable frequency reduction rate as the first preset rate S1 in the frequency reduction adjustment process of the compressor.
When the compressor is in the stable frequency stage or the frequency reduction stage, the discharge pressure threshold P at the moment is presetdmaxCorresponding second preset positive deviation value B, when the real-time exhaust pressure value P is detectedd≥Pdmax+ B, it shows that the difference between the suction pressure and the discharge pressure of the compressor is too large due to too large discharge pressure value of the current compressor, and the adjustment of the pressure difference of the compressor is needed. The compressor is controlled to perform down-conversion at a second preset rate S2 corresponding to the current frequency modulation stage. The second preset rate S2 is determined experimentally by making the value of the discharge pressure Pd≥ PdmaxThe + B condition, selecting different frequency reduction rates to carry out the frequency reduction regulation of the compressor, and finally selectingThe most suitable down-conversion rate is used as the second preset rate S2 during the down-conversion process of the compressor.
When the compressor is in the stable frequency stage or the frequency reduction stage, the discharge pressure threshold P at the moment is presetdmaxCorresponding third preset positive deviation value C when detecting real-time exhaust pressure value Pd≥Pdmax+ C, it indicates that the current compressor discharge pressure value is too large, which results in too large difference between the compressor suction pressure and discharge pressure, and needs to adjust the compressor pressure difference. The compressor is controlled to perform down-conversion at a third preset rate S3 corresponding to the current frequency modulation stage. The third preset rate S3 is experimentally measured by making the discharge pressure value Pd≥ PdmaxAnd C, selecting different frequency reduction rates to perform compressor frequency reduction adjustment, and finally selecting the most suitable frequency reduction rate as a third preset rate S3 in the process of performing frequency reduction adjustment on the compressor. It will be understood that the discharge pressure value P is due to the fact that the compressor is in the same stable frequency phase or reduced frequency phasedAccording to different frequency reduction rates, frequency reduction is carried out according to different frequency reduction rates, so that the fluctuation of the compressor frequency under corresponding conditions is stable. Therefore, the first, second and third preset positive deviation values a, B and C are preset to correspond to different exhaust pressure values PdAnd detecting and adjusting the frequency.
It should be noted that, in the three different frequency stages, the compressor is subjected to frequency reduction, so that the real-time exhaust pressure value of the compressor is decreased, the real-time suction pressure is increased, and the difference between the real-time suction pressure and the real-time exhaust pressure of the compressor is further reduced. When the compressor real-time exhaust pressure value P is reduced by frequency reductiondIs less than or equal to exhaust pressure threshold value PdmaxWhen the corresponding first preset negative deviation value D is subtracted, the current real-time exhaust pressure value is controlled within a reasonable range, the compressor runs safely, and the condition of running beyond mechanical strength cannot occur. Also, the compressor will not be at the real-time discharge pressure value P in view of the detected and calculated deviationsdIs less than or equal to exhaust pressure threshold value PdmaxThe frequency reduction is stopped at all times, but the deviation is taken into accountObtaining a first predetermined negative deviation D when Pd≤PdmaxAnd D, stopping the frequency reduction.
In addition, in the process of performing compressor down-regulation, the discharge pressure of the compressor is reduced by down-regulation, so that the current frequency regulation stage of the compressor can jump to another frequency regulation stage for frequency regulation. Such as Pd≥PdmaxWhen the pressure is in the range of + A, the real-time exhaust pressure is reduced through frequency reduction regulation, and the real-time exhaust pressure value of the compressor is regulated to Pdmax+B≤Pd≤Pdmax+ A, then further according to the real-time exhaust pressure value Pd≥ Pdmax+ B, down-regulation is performed to reduce the real-time discharge pressure value P of the compressord. Analogizing until the real-time exhaust pressure value P of the compressordIs less than or equal to exhaust pressure threshold value PdmaxAnd stopping reducing the frequency when the corresponding first preset negative deviation value D is subtracted.
On the other hand, when the compressor is in the up-conversion stage, the discharge pressure threshold P at that time is presetdmaxCorresponding to the first preset negative deviation value D, when the real-time exhaust pressure value P is detectedd≥PdmaxAnd D, indicating that the current compressor discharge pressure value is too large, so that the difference between the suction pressure and the discharge pressure of the compressor is too large, and controlling the compressor to stop increasing the frequency. It should be noted that, since the deviation of the discharge pressure is a negative deviation value at the compressor up-frequency stage, the real-time discharge pressure value P is performeddWith exhaust pressure threshold PdmaxIn the comparison process, the exhaust pressure threshold value P needs to be compareddmaxThe corresponding first preset negative deviation value D is subtracted. After the frequency increase is stopped, if the compressor is in a stable frequency stage at this time, if it is detected that the real-time exhaust pressure value reaches the exhaust pressure threshold at this time, the frequency of the compressor is adjusted by referring to the stable frequency stage.
